Latitude and longitude of Xidi

Satellite map of Xidi

Xidi (Chinese: 西递; pinyin: Xīdì, also Xi'di, or Xi Di, literally West Post), is a village in southern Anhui province (Yi County), in China, which was declared a part of the "Ancient Villages in Southern Anhui" World Heritage Site by UNESCO in 2000, along with the village of Hongcun.

Latitude: 29° 54' 9.59" N
Longitude: 117° 59' 8.99" E

Read about Xidi in the Wikipedia Satellite map of Xidi in Google Maps

GPS coordinates of Xidi, China

Download as JSON